Design and performance study of a small-scale waste heat recovery turbine

The paper presents the design process of a radial-axial turbine working with SES36 working fluid. First, the mean-line design process is performed and then the geometry is developed. In the next stage the numerical verification is performed taking into account the real properties of the working fluid. The properties are implemented via a look-up table and by a modified Benedict-Webb-Rubin equation of state. The presented turbine is characterized by a very small stator outflow angle which is about 4.5◦ but despite this small value, the efficiency of the machine is relatively high and equal to about 88%. The influence of internal leakages has also been investigated.
